The bike is an 09 1200L - I extended the foot peg by getting longer bolts and spacers - moved it out 1.5" and that worked perfect.

I put a piece of female Velcro on the edge of the bag's lid where it contacts the side cover and will be putting a small piece of 3M paint protectant film on the new side cover I had painted when it comes in. I'm sorry I can't find the website where I found the film but a Google search should do it, that's how I found it.
